CBADtt...we deleted the rear seats altogether and a custom sub enclosure was made. What's over top of it is the base for the faux Speedster "cowls"...
Here is pic without the Speedster cowl pieces (3 pieces...a base that fits across the car and 2 top cowl covers). I take the 2 top pieces off and keep the base on when I want to put the top down. I keep the cowl pieces in leather covers and they sit behind the seats. The process takes about a minute or two.
PS...We fit a single 13" JL TW5 flat sub in the back with a port on the driver's side. We kept the front stock sub but powered it with more power. All Hertz amplification and front sound stage separates. It's like a damn amphitheater now...I played Hotel California with the top down and it was downright awe inspiring.

Engine mods will be in a couple of months...it'll be a Stage 1 Switzer E911 Flex Fuel setup. Stage 2 (if I choose) would be getting into the internals. Stage 1 should get me between 700-800whp.
Currently, I only have the Switzer ECU upgrade (100hp increase) and muffler bypass with a 200cell cat.
